To truly value the role of a Level 2 electrician, it is necessary to comprehend the landscape of electrical power supply. Power starts its journey at a generation plant, travels through high-voltage transmission lines, and is then stepped down through substations before reaching local distribution networks. It's at this last, where the service lines branch off to specific premises, that the expertise of a Level 2 ASP (Accredited Provider) becomes important. Unlike a standard electrician who normally deals with the customer's side of the meter, a Level 2 professional is authorised to deal with the critical infrastructure leading up check here to and consisting of the point of supply.
The pathway to becoming a Level 2 electrician is extensive, demanding a significant financial investment in training, experience, and adherence to strict safety protocols. Individuals should initially be fully qualified electricians, holding all essential licenses and showing a thorough understanding of electrical principles and circuitry regulations. Following this fundamental credentials, they undertake specialised training that covers the intricacies of overhead and underground service lines, metering devices, and network connections. This innovative education is not simply theoretical; it involves substantial useful experience under the supervision of skilled Level 2 operators, guaranteeing a deep understanding of real-world situations and prospective threats.
Accreditation is an essential differentiator for these professionals. Each state and territory has its own regulatory body that governs the accreditation process, guaranteeing that just those who fulfill the highest standards of proficiency and safety are authorised to perform this important work. This accreditation is not a one-time achievement; it needs continuous professional advancement and regular audits to keep, ensuring that Level 2 electricians remain current with evolving market requirements, technological improvements, and safety guidelines. This commitment to continuous knowing is vital in a sector where security is vital and the effects of error can be serious.
The services supplied by Level 2 electricians are diverse and essential. They are the go-to experts for brand-new power connections, whether for a freshly constructed home, a commercial development, or a significant restoration requiring an upgrade to the existing supply. This includes whatever from setting up new service poles and customer mains to linking the residential or commercial property to the overhead or underground network. They are also responsible for upgrading existing services to accommodate increased power needs, a typical requirement as families acquire more appliances and businesses broaden their operations.
Beyond new setups and upgrades, Level 2 experts are regularly called upon for disconnections and reconnections, a needed job throughout significant remodellings, demolitions, or when a home is changing ownership. They are skilled in fault finding and repairs on the network side of the meter, attending to issues such as damaged overhead lines, faulty underground cable televisions, or problems with service merges. Their know-how in these locations is essential for bring back power quickly and securely, minimising disruption to residents and services. Additionally, they play an essential role in meter relocation and upgrades, guaranteeing that metering equipment is properly installed, adjusted, and compliant with all appropriate guidelines. This is especially crucial with the arrival of clever meters, which need specialised knowledge for installation and combination.
Security is, without doubt, the cornerstone of Level 2 electrical work. Dealing with live electrical systems at the point of supply carries fundamental risks, and these specialists are trained to alleviate these threats through precise planning, adherence to stringent security procedures, and making use of specialised devices. They are acutely aware of the capacity for electrocution, fire, and other threats, and their training instils a culture of watchfulness and care. This includes understanding exclusion zones, carrying out lockout/tag-out treatments, and using personal protective devices (PPE) created for high-voltage environments. Their deep understanding of electrical physics and network configurations allows them to assess dangers precisely and implement suitable control measures.
